Frequently Asked Questions about Katy
How much are Studio apartments in Katy?
There are currently 22 Studio Apartments in Katy with rent ranges from $981 to $1,683 with an average price of $1,152.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Katy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Katy ranges from $468 to $4,074 with an average monthly rent of $1,415.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Katy c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Katy range from $505 to $4,263.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,820.
How expensive are Katy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 137 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Katy on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,125 to $5,534 - averaging $2,404 for the location.
